243 Mr. Durkan asked the Minister for Arts, Sport and Tourism if he or his Department will directly or indirectly offer financial support towards the building of swimming pools in County Kildare;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[15441/05]

Kildare County Council has applied for grant aid under the local authority swimming pool programme for the replacement of the existing swimming pools in Naas and Athy. In March this year, I approved the contract documents for the replacement of the pool in Naas and this approval allows the council to invite tenders for the work proposed. In the same month, I also approved the preliminary report for the replacement of the swimming pool in Athy and this approval allows the council to have detailed contract documents prepared for the project. Both projects will be considered further when the relevant documentation is submitted.

The programme has four principal stages in respect of a swimming pool project, which are, in order of progress: feasibility study-preliminary report; contract documents; tender; and construction. The Office of Public Works, which acts as technical adviser to my Department, evaluates each stage and local authorities cannot proceed to the next stage of a project unless prior approval issues from my Department. Grant aid is formally allocated when the tender for the project is approved.
